Serving 205 students in grades Prekindergarten-8, Bartonville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 6-9%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 27%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 10-14%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 30%).
The student:teacher ratio of 7:1 is lower than the Illinois state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 33%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the Illinois state average of 55%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view

Bartonville Elementary School's student population of 205 students has declined by 36% over five school years.
The teacher population of 28 teachers has grown by 27% over five school years.

School Rankings

Bartonville Elementary School ranks within the bottom 50% of all 3,542 schools in Illinois (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Bartonville Elementary School is 0.52,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.69.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
